Bistable Microwave Oscillator Based on Nonlinear Magnetostatic Wave Transmission Line
Résumé
A microwave oscillator containing a GaAs amplifier, a rnagnetostatic spin wave (MSW) signal-to-noise enhancer (SNE) used as a nonlinear transmission line, directional couplers, and a variable attenuator has been designed and investigated. It was shown, that nonlinearity of the SNE and amplifier resulted in a bistability in the system : two different levels of oscillation power correspond to one attenuator setting. The oscillator was switched on under action of external short low power microwave pulses.
